  8. There was a column yesterday by Donn Esmonde of the Buffalo News on the Buffalo Sabres resurgance. In it, he stated that the Sabres were the first professional team to institute variable ticket pricing where ticket prices vary from game to game based on the quality of the opponent and day of the week. I was surprised by this statement(that no one else has done this) and was wondering if anyone knows of other pro sports teams that have gone down this route.
